Job Description

HR Talent Acquisition Specialist

Location: Dallas, TX 75252 (On-Site)

Pay: $50,000-$65,000K

About The Job:

We are seeking a highly organized and proactive HR Talent Acquisition Specialist to join our fast-growing startup. As we grow, the role of our People and HR department becomes ever more crucial. We are seeking an HR Talent Acquisition Specialist to bring organization, efficiency, and support to our Director of People and HR. This role is not just about managing schedules and tasks; it's about being the cornerstone on which effective human resource management is built. In this role, you will be instrumental in fostering a nurturing, productive work environment, directly impacting our team's well-being and the company's culture.

Responsibilities:

  • Act as the primary point of contact for HR-related inquiries, directing them to relevant team members or addressing them directly.
  • Manage and coordinate HR projects and initiatives, ensuring timely execution and follow-up.
  • Support the director in developing and implementing HR strategies and policies.
  • Assist in the organization and maintenance of employee records, ensuring compliance with legal and company standards.
  • Coordinate recruitment processes, including sourcing candidates, scheduling interviews, liaising with candidates, and preparing interview materials.
  • Recruit candidates by actively sourcing through various platforms, including job boards and LinkedIn.
  • Conduct interviews and support the recruitment team in selecting the best candidates for open positions.
  • Facilitate onboarding and training programs for new employees.
  • Conduct new hire orientation sessions to introduce new employees to company culture, policies, and their role.
  • Organize and manage internal HR communications, ensuring clarity and timely dissemination of information.
  • Proactively manage the director’s schedule, focusing on optimizing their time and resources.
  • Prepare detailed reports, presentations, and documentation for HR initiatives and meetings.
  • Serve as a liaison between the HR department and other departments, enhancing interdepartmental communication and collaboration.
  • Implement and maintain systems to improve departmental organization and efficiency.

Requirements:

  • Intermediary understanding of HR operations, including employment law, recruitment, and employee relations.
  • Proven experience in recruiting, including setting up interviews and conducting new hire onboarding and orientation.
  • Exceptional organizational skills, with a talent for balancing multiple priorities in a dynamic environment.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ills, capable of building relationships across various levels of the organization.
  • High level of discretion and professionalism, particularly in handling sensitive employee information.
  • Proficiency in HR software, office tools, and technology.
